氧化 Ubuntu:默认采用 Rust 实用工具
💡
原文中文,约4900字,阅读约需12分钟。
📝
内容提要
Ubuntu计划用Rust编写工具替代传统GNU工具,推出命令行工具oxidizr供用户测试,旨在提升系统弹性和安全性,预计在2025年发布的Ubuntu 25.10中实施。社区反应积极,但对变革持谨慎态度。
🎯
关键要点
- Ubuntu计划用Rust编写工具替代传统GNU工具,推出命令行工具oxidizr供用户测试。
- 目标是提升系统弹性和安全性,预计在2025年发布的Ubuntu 25.10中实施。
- 社区反应积极,但对如此重大的改变持谨慎态度。
- Ubuntu庆祝了自2024年首次发布以来的20周年,展望未来20年。
- 西格尔呼吁根据用户需求评估发行版的基础,选择以弹性、性能和可维护性为核心的工具。
- 采用Rust将有助于增加贡献者数量,提供更安全的代码框架。
- oxidizr工具允许用户在低风险情况下快速更换Rust实用程序。
- 用户可以通过命令行启用或禁用Rust版本的实用程序。
- 社区对转向uutils的反应不一,有人担心放弃GNU组件。
- 西格尔重申这一变化并不意味着放弃GNU组件,而是用更现代的组件替换核心工具。
- Seager与开发团队讨论了在Ubuntu 25.10中默认使用uutils的计划,强调需要谨慎行事。
- 如果转换不成功,可以在LTS版本中及时恢复,确保稳定性和可靠性。
❓
延伸问答
Ubuntu为什么决定用Rust替代传统的GNU工具?
Ubuntu希望通过使用Rust提升系统的弹性和安全性,Rust提供了更可靠的代码框架。
oxidizr工具的主要功能是什么?
oxidizr是一个命令行工具,允许用户在低风险情况下快速启用或禁用基于Rust的实用程序。
社区对Ubuntu转向Rust的反应如何?
社区反应积极,但对这一重大改变持谨慎态度,有人担心放弃GNU组件。
Ubuntu 25.10计划何时发布?
Ubuntu 25.10计划于2025年10月发布。
使用Rust的优势是什么?
Rust提供了C/C++的性能,同时提高了代码的安全性和可靠性,适合基础软件开发。
如果Rust工具转换不成功,Ubuntu会如何处理?
如果转换不成功,Ubuntu可以在LTS版本中及时恢复到传统的GNU工具,确保系统稳定性。
➡️